Escape to Getaway Bay for some seriously sweet romance. This complete collection features four sweet romance novels that will leave you stranded with a hero! You'll get swept away with a billionaire, a Navy SEAL, a quarterback, and a cowboy billionaire in four love stories that will leave you breathless.

Stranded with the Hidden Billionaire: A freak storm has her sliding down the mountain...right into the arms of her ex.

Stranded with the SEAL: Friends who ditch her. A pod of killer whales. A limping cruise ship. All reasons Iris finds herself stranded on an deserted island with the handsome Navy SEAL...

Stranded with the Quarterback: He can throw a precision pass, but he's dead in the water in matters of the heart...

Stranded with the Cowboy Billionaire: Tired of the dating scene, a cowboy billionaire puts up an Internet ad to find a woman to come out to a deserted island with him to see if they can make a love connection...

3-time USA Today bestselling author Elana Johnson writes adult contemporary beach romance. She is the author of over 130 books across two names, and there's nothing better than sun, sand, and swoon-worthy kisses! Unless it's a sweet-and-sexy cowboy - read those under her pen name of Liz Isaacson. Or an emotional, heartfelt women's fiction novel - read those under her pen name of Jessie Newton.

These 4 stories about the McLaughlin sisters were fun to read. Who would have thought that all four sisters happened to meet their future husbands by being stranded with them? But that is what happened and it was fun to read about each of their adventures. For those of you who remember the TV show Gilligan’s Island, two of the stories had that vibe which I loved about them.

THE PERFECT STORM
I loved this story mainly because it was so unusual. To have 2 people who end up being trapped on a mountain be ex-boyfriend and girlfriend was new and different. Eden is one very capable woman and a true survivor. Holden is someone who prefers to be out of the limelight. He had a lot of issues that he had to recover from and now seeing Eden again, he needs to convince her that he is not the same man who broke her heart. It was really a fun story to read.

THE OVERBOARD MISTAKE
Iris going on this cruise was her first mistake and meeting Justin, the Navy SEAL, was her second. They were going on a simple cruise around the Hawaiian Islands, what could do wrong? A pod of killer orcas is what and Justin convinced that the ship is sinking.

This story was full of adventure and how to survive without anything but what Iris’s sister had packed in the emergency kit. You get to see how Justin and Iris manage to survive on a deserted island with only Justin’s SEAL experience.

THE CRUISING FIASCO
Orchid certainly did not want to go on a cruise, especially a singles cruise. But she found herself there and decided to make the best of it. Maine, a professional footballer, wants to get away from the limelight and have a real relationship. Their meeting started off on the wrong foot but when they found themselves and a ship’s steward trapped on a desert island it got better. But can Iris come to terms with the person Maine has to be when they are both back in Hawaii?

THE SAND BAR MISSTEP
This one was fun because Ivy and Mason were not in the same predicament that her sisters were in when they were stranded. Ivy is one woman who knows how to get things done. She is not shy and does not have the same problems dealing with men as her sisters. Mason does have a lot of baggage and a hard time expressing his thoughts and feelings. It is fun to read how these two overcome their major differences and communicate. If I say any more than it would give you spoilers, you will have to read it for yourself.
